Defining Simplicity with Earthy Elements:
Embrace the beauty of minimalism by incorporating natural materials like wood, jute, and cotton. Neutral tones and muted colors create a tranquil atmosphere, allowing your mind to unwind and recharge. Earthy elements bring a sense of groundedness and connection to the natural world.
Cultural Tapestry: Embracing Traditional Crafts:
Celebrate India's diverse craftsmanship by incorporating traditional textiles, paintings, and sculptures into your bedroom décor. Hand-woven rugs, intricately carved furniture, and ethnic artwork add layers of visual interest and tell stories of rich cultural heritage.
The Symphony of Colors: A Vibrant Palette:
India's vibrant colors are like an invitation to joy and energy. Bold hues like saffron, turquoise, and emerald can energize your space, while softer shades of pink, lavender, and mint create a calming ambiance. Experiment with color combinations that resonate with your personality.
Holistic Harmony: Incorporating Sacred Spaces:
Create a dedicated corner for meditation or spiritual practices. This serene space can feature a small altar, calming artwork, and soft lighting. It serves as a sanctuary for reflection and rejuvenation, promoting inner peace and balance.
Light and Shadow: The Art of Balance:
Harness the power of natural light to create a bright and airy atmosphere. Large windows or skylights can flood the room with sunlight, while sheer curtains can filter harsh rays, creating a soft and inviting ambiance. Layer different lighting options, from ambient to task lighting, to set the mood and create pockets of coziness.

Feng Shui Principles: Harmonizing Energy Flow:
Apply the principles of Feng Shui to optimize the energy flow in your bedroom. Position your bed in a commanding position, head towards the east or south, and avoid placing mirrors directly across from the bed. Keep the space clutter-free and incorporate elements of nature to create a harmonious and balanced environment.
Space-Saving Solutions for Compact Bedrooms:
In smaller bedrooms, maximize space with smart storage solutions. Opt for multifunctional furniture like a bed with built-in drawers or a wardrobe with a pull-out desk. Utilize vertical space with floating shelves and wall-mounted storage units. Clever organization and space-saving ideas can create a sense of spaciousness even in compact areas.
Incorporating Sustainable Elements: A Greener Approach:
Embrace eco-friendly practices by incorporating sustainable elements into your bedroom décor. Choose furniture made from recycled or renewable materials, such as bamboo or reclaimed wood. Opt for energy-efficient lighting and appliances. Add indoor plants to purify the air and bring a touch of nature indoors.
